from __future__ import print_function
import sys, signal, atexit
from upm import pyupm_nlgpio16 as sensorObj

def main():
    # Instantiate a NLGPIO16 Module on the default UART (/dev/ttyACM0)
    sensor = sensorObj.NLGPIO16()

    ## Exit handlers ##
    # This stops python from printing a stacktrace when you hit control-C
    def SIGINTHandler(signum, frame):
        raise SystemExit

    # This function lets you run code on exit
    def exitHandler():
        print("Exiting")
        sys.exit(0)

    # Register exit handlers
    atexit.register(exitHandler)
    signal.signal(signal.SIGINT, SIGINTHandler)

    # get the Version
    print("Device Version:", sensor.getVersion())
    # read the gpio at pin 3
    print("GPIO 3 Value:", sensor.gpioRead(3))
    # read the analog voltage at pin 5
    print("Analog 5 Voltage:", sensor.analogReadVolts(5))
    # set the gpio at pin 14 to HIGH
    sensor.gpioSet(14)

if __name__ == '__main__':
    main()
